Responsibility: Proceed at your own risk. 🔍 Understanding the Huawei EC6108V9 The Huawei EC6108V9 is a popular carrier-grade Android IPTV box. It is widely available on the secondhand market, making it a favorite for hardware hackers. Hardware Specifications SoC: Hisilicon Hi3798M (ARM Cortex-A7) RAM: 1GB DDR3 Storage: 4GB or 8GB eMMC flash Connectivity: Ethernet port, Wi-Fi, USB 2.0 ports, and MicroSD slot While Android is fine for media, it lacks advanced networking features. OpenWrt replaces Android entirely, turning the box into a powerhouse for routing, ad-blocking, and lightweight self-hosting. 📥 Finding the Newest OpenWrt Firmware Because the EC6108V9 uses a Hisilicon processor, it is not part of the main, official OpenWrt build branch. Instead, it relies on community-driven builds. Where to Look GitHub Repositories: Search for "Hi3798M OpenWrt" or "EC6108V9 OpenWrt" on GitHub. Developers frequently publish auto-compiled nightly builds here. Right.com.cn Forums: This massive Chinese router forum is the birthplace of most EC6108V9 custom firmware. Use a translation tool to find the absolute newest optimized builds. Telegram Channels: Several specialized tech channels focus on "armbian" and "openwrt" for TV boxes. What to Download Ensure you download the specific image for the Hi3798M chip. Method 2: The TTL Serial Method (For Advanced Users) If your box ignores the USB drive or has a locked bootloader, you must open the case and use a USB-to-TTL adapter. Open the case: Pop open the plastic shell of the EC6108V9. This box is essentially a router hidden inside Locate UART pins: Look on the motherboard for pins labeled GND, RX, and TX. Connect adapter: Connect them to your USB-to-TTL module (Cross RX to TX, and TX to RX). Thanks to the 1GB of RAM, quite a lot: Smart Home Hub: Install Home Assistant in a docker container to manage smart devices. Ad-Blocking: Run AdGuard Home or Pi-hole at the network level to remove ads from all devices in your home. Private VPN: Install WireGuard or OpenVPN to securely access your home network from anywhere. File Server: Hook up an external hard drive to a USB port and create a low-power NAS using Samba or NFS.
